计算机内存主要有哪些

计算机内存是计算机中非常重要的组成部分,它承担着临时存储数据的功能。计算机内存主要有以下几种类型:

计算机内存详解:类型、功能以及使用方法

1. 内存芯片:内存芯片是计算机内存中最基本的构建单元,一般采用DRAM(动态随机存取存储器)技术制造。内存芯片按照容量可以分为KB级别到GB级别的不同规格。

2. 内存模块:内存模块是内存芯片的集合体,一般采用DIMM(双列直插式内存模块)或者SO-DIMM(小型双列直插式内存模块)的形式。内存模块按照接口类型可以分为DDR3、DDR4等不同规格。

3. 缓存:缓存是位于处理器内部的一种高速存储器,用于临时存储CPU频繁访问的数据和指令。缓存分为L1、L2和L3三级缓存,容量逐级增大,速度逐级降低。

4. 虚拟内存:虚拟内存是一种利用硬盘上的空间模拟扩展内存容量的技术。当计算机内存不足时,虚拟内存可以将一部分数据移到硬盘上,腾出内存空间供其他程序使用。

除了不同类型的内存,计算机内存还有以下几个主要功能:

1. 数据存储:计算机内存用于存储程序运行过程中所需的数据,包括变量、数组、对象等。这些数据被加载到内存中后,CPU可以直接访问,提高了系统的运行效率。

2. 程序执行:计算机内存中存放着运行中的程序代码和指令。CPU通过读取内存中的指令,按照程序的逻辑执行相应的操作。

3. 缓存加速:缓存作为高速存储器,可以暂时存储CPU频繁访问的数据和指令,提高系统的运行速度。

4. 虚拟内存管理:虚拟内存可以将部分数据从内存移到硬盘上,实现内存的扩展。虚拟内存管理算法可以根据程序运行的需要,自动调整内存的使用情况。

正确使用计算机内存可以提高系统的运行效率和稳定性。以下是一些使用计算机内存的方法:

1. 合理安排内存占用:在同时运行多个程序时,应合理分配各个程序所需的内存,避免单个程序占用过多导致系统变慢或崩溃。

2. 定期清理内存:清理不必要的内存占用,可以通过关闭不需要的程序或者使用系统自带的优化工具来实现。

3. 升级内存容量:如果计算机内存容量不足,可以考虑升级内存条的容量,以提高系统的运行效率和性能。

总结:计算机内存是计算机中非常重要的组成部分,它的类型和功能多种多样。合理了解和使用计算机内存可以提高系统的运行效率和稳定性。希望本文对读者有所帮助,进一步了解和掌握计算机内存的相关知识。